Vulnerability Description
Node.js < 14.11.0 is vulnerable to HTTP denial of service (DoS) attacks based on delayed requests submission which can make the server unable to accept new connections.

What is CVE-2020-8251?
CVE-2020-8251 is a vulnerability with a CVSS score of 7.5 (HIGH). Node.js < 14.11.0 is vulnerable to HTTP denial of service (DoS) attacks based on delayed requests submission which can make the server unable to accept new connections.
